The big thing I would suggest is to download the app early, get familiar with it, and establish your account. Setting up your account will require a few minutes, including time to enter your credit card information.

When you reach your destination, the driver will close out the ride and the fare will be charged to your credit card. You don't have to do anything further. Tips are not included in the fare. Tips are not required, but they are greatly appreciated.
You will also be given an opportunity to rate your driver. Your rating is very important to the driver, and unfortunately less than 50% of riders rate their drivers. Whenever a rider
does not rate a good driver 5 stars, that hurts the driver because it gives more weight to the occasional lower rating. Five stars is an A; 4 stars is an
F -- seriously, it is.
